Legendary letters

I lay myself down
on barren grounds,
untouched before
my eyes became aware
they were there.

On this solid mass letters form,
out of nowhere,
like lichen on rock, breaking it down
into a substrate.

I open my hands over it
and feel the letters migrate,
grouping into symbols

that heat my hands.
The legendary letters are casting
spells,
mythology to mystic
words
rooted in meaning

beyond
the tangible rock.

Hot breath,
a dragon woke
from the words,

wings beating
to lift me up

to see a new world
grow into being
future

if only
I understand
what gift of life
just came to me.
